02/25/2007 - Alkmaar, Holland (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- AZ missed a great opportunity to move into second place on Sunday as they were held to a 1-1 draw by a 10-man Ajax side at Alkmaarder Hout.

The result leaves the Amsterdam club one point clear of AZ for second place, but the draw pushes league-leaders PSV further ahead of the pack, as the Eindhoven squad recorded a 1-0 win over Groningen on Saturday, moving seven points clear.

Edgar Davids received his second yellow card just before halftime, reducing Ajax to 10 men, but the visitors struck first anyway 20 minutes into the second half. Kenneth Perez put Ajax on the board but the home side, despite its numerical advantage, could only muster a draw as Maarten Martens equalized 11 minutes before time.

Danny Koevermans nearly put AZ ahead after 11 minutes as his header from a Demy De Zeeuw corner had to be cleared off the line by Ajax defender George Ogararu.

Davids then almost handed the opener to AZ minutes later when he was dispossessed by Julian Jenner, who then fired a shot just over the cross bar from the edge of the box.

Ajax held up under the pressure and Jaap Stam's free-kick from 25-yards out nearly put them on top but it came back off the post.

The match changed in the 45th when Davids picked up his second yellow card in a three-minute span, forcing manager Henk ten Cate to shuffle his lineup.

After the restart, it was Ajax who were the stronger side despite playing a man down. Ryan Babel forced a nice save from AZ keeper Boy Waterman before Leonardo created the opener in the 65th minute by carrying the ball into the box and dropping it to Perez, who slammed it home from 12-yards out to make it 1-0.

AZ was able to level the contest for good in the 79th on a nice piece of play from Koevermans, who worked room for himself and then crossed to Martens. The second-half sub then tapped the ball across the line to grab a point for the hosts.

In other Eredivisie play on Sunday, Feyenoord played to a 3-3 deadlock with Den Haag, NAC blanked Excelsior 2-0 and RKC Waalwijk moved to within one point of avoiding relegation with a 3-1 triumph over Vitesse.

Super Bowl 2009, the Arizona Cardinals and the Pittsburgh Steelers.

Let’s take a look at the Super Bowl 2009 betting odds and the betting line and figure out where they’ve been and where they are going to go.

MySportsbook.com put up the Super Bowl 2009 betting odds late on Sunday night with the Pittsburgh Steelers favored by 6.5 points and a total betting line at 47.5 points.

Since then, however, the Super Bowl 2009 betting odds have seen a good deal of movement and you’ll want to be on top of where they are likely to move to make sure you get the best line value for the big game.

Since opening, the Super Bowl 2009 betting lines went to Steelers -7 in the span of roughly 3 hours but were quickly bought back down just minutes later to 6.5 again.

After that is took about 5-6 more hours before the betting line went back to -7 where it has sat for a while now and is likely to remain. The opening betting total of 47.5 was bet down right after the line became available and went to 47 within minutes.

Roughly a day later it has been bet even further down to the 46.5 tally it currently is set at.

Roughly 60% of gamblers seem to be on the Cardinals here so the point spread will be bet down and a 7.5 would not last very long at all with many taking the early 6.5 in hopes of finding a potential middle in the Super Bowl 2009 betting odds.

If you like Arizona and see a 7.5, I’d take it as soon as possible because it’s unlikely to last. For Pittsburgh backers, the -7 might be the best you’ll be able to find but a 6.5 is definitely possible close to game time.

Regarding the Super Bowl 2009 betting odds for the total, most tracked gamblers are already on the over and with those who took the under 47.5 already securing a middle on the over 46.5, the only way I see it moving is back up to 47 so if you like the over, I’d recommend betting now.

Mayweather picked to beat De La Hoya
LAS VEGAS, NEVADA -- Golden Boy Oscar De La Hoya and his rival Floyd Mayweather Jr. arrived at the MGM Grand here Wednesday amid the pomp and pandemonium befitting two of the biggest stars in the sport who are about to duke it out for the WBC super welterweight crown this Saturday (Sunday in Manila).

As of Wednesday, MySportsbook.com closed its book with Mayweather a favorite to defeat De La Hoya at -170 (a $100 bet wins $70), while De La Hoya is a +140 underdog (a $100 bet wins $140).

Mayweather arrived at about 11:30 a.m. on a big truck with his face and a big "World's Best Pound-for-Pound" sign scribbled across the vehicle. He was accompanied by his entourage made up of rappers and his training team.

A crowd of close to 3,000 eager fans packed the MGM Grand lobby, with their cameras in tow, all trying to vie for position to get a good angle at Mayweather, who is acknowledged as the world's best fighter pound-for-pound.

Eric Gomez, Golden Boy Promotions vice-president, described the fan turnout as "amazing" and swore he had never seen anything quite like this event.

"The crowd was fantastic. Everybody was just too eager to see the two fighters," said ALA manager Michael Aldeguer, who was among those who waited at the lobby together with his ward Rey "Boom Boom" Bautista and AJ Banal.

De La Hoya made his own grand entrance at the hotel lobby at around 12:30 p.m. accompanied by GBP chief executive officer Richard Schaefer and trainer Freddie Roach.

The same group of fans who trooped to see Mayweather also lingered around to get a close look at De La Hoya, who has been secretly working out at a Las Vegas gym for days after arriving from his main training camp in Puerto Rico.

The golden boy then took part in a closed-door afternoon workout with Bautista and Banal. The two, along with Aldeguer and wife Christine, as well as an HBO crew were the only ones allowed inside the gym.

De La Hoya and Mayweather take part in today's final press conference before the official weigh-in this Friday.

Ring Magazine, the acknowledged bible of boxing, reported in its June 2007 issue that 12 out of 20 boxing experts it interviewed have favored Mayweather to defeat De la Hoya, with only 8 favoring the latter.

But Filipino ring icon Manny Pacquiao said in a recent interview with The Freeman's Emmanuel Villaruel that De La Hoya will win by unanimous decision over Mayweather.
